type EventApplicationOverserviced ¶
type EventApplicationOverserviced struct {
ApplicationAddr string `protobuf:"bytes,1,opt,name=application_addr,json=applicationAddr,proto3" json:"application_addr,omitempty"`
SupplierOperatorAddr string `protobuf:"bytes,2,opt,name=supplier_operator_addr,json=supplierOperatorAddr,proto3" json:"supplier_operator_addr,omitempty"`
// Expected burn is the amount the supplier is claiming for work done
// to service the application during the session.
// This is usually the amount in the Claim submitted.
ExpectedBurn *v1beta1.Coin `protobuf:"bytes,3,opt,name=expected_burn,json=expectedBurn,proto3" json:"expected_burn,omitempty"`
// Effective burn is the amount that is actually being paid to the supplier
// for the work done. It is less than the expected burn (claim amount) and
// is a function of the relay mining algorithm.
// E.g. The application's stake divided by the number of suppliers in a session.
EffectiveBurn *v1beta1.Coin `protobuf:"bytes,4,opt,name=effective_burn,json=effectiveBurn,proto3" json:"effective_burn,omitempty"`
// contains filtered or unexported fields
}
EventApplicationOverserviced is emitted when an application has less stake than what a supplier is claiming (i.e. amount available for burning is insufficient). This means the following will ALWAYS be strictly true: effective_burn < expected_burn.

type EventClaimExpired ¶
type EventClaimExpired struct {
Claim *proof.Claim `protobuf:"bytes,1,opt,name=claim,proto3" json:"claim,omitempty"`
// The reason why the claim expired, leading to a Supplier being penalized (i.e. burn).
ExpirationReason ClaimExpirationReason `` /* 155-byte string literal not displayed */
// Number of relays claimed to be in the session tree.
NumRelays uint64 `protobuf:"varint,3,opt,name=num_relays,json=numRelays,proto3" json:"num_relays,omitempty"`
// Number of compute units claimed as a function of the number of relays
// and the compute units per relay for the particular service.
NumClaimedComputeUnits uint64 `` /* 132-byte string literal not displayed */
// Number of estimated compute units claimed as a function of the number of claimed
// compute units and the relay difficulty multiplier for the particular service.
NumEstimatedComputeUnits uint64 `` /* 138-byte string literal not displayed */
// The uPOKT coin claimed to be rewarded for the work done as a function of
// the number of estimated compute units and the compute units to token multiplier.
ClaimedUpokt *v1beta1.Coin `protobuf:"bytes,6,opt,name=claimed_upokt,json=claimedUpokt,proto3" json:"claimed_upokt,omitempty"`
// contains filtered or unexported fields
}
EventClaimExpired is an event emitted during settlement whenever a claim requiring an onchain proof doesn't have one. The claim cannot be settled, leading to that work never being rewarded.

type MintAllocationPercentages ¶
type MintAllocationPercentages struct {
// dao is the percentage of the minted tokens which are sent
// to the DAO reward address during claim settlement.
Dao float64 `protobuf:"fixed64,1,opt,name=dao,proto3" json:"dao,omitempty"`
// proposer is the percentage of the minted tokens which are sent
// to the block proposer account address during claim settlement.
Proposer float64 `protobuf:"fixed64,2,opt,name=proposer,proto3" json:"proposer,omitempty"`
// supplier is the percentage of the minted tokens which are sent
// to the block supplier account address during claim settlement.
Supplier float64 `protobuf:"fixed64,3,opt,name=supplier,proto3" json:"supplier,omitempty"`
// source_owner is the percentage of the minted tokens which are sent
// to the service source owner account address during claim settlement.
SourceOwner float64 `protobuf:"fixed64,4,opt,name=source_owner,json=sourceOwner,proto3" json:"source_owner,omitempty"`
// allocation_application is the percentage of the minted tokens which are sent
// to the application account address during claim settlement.
Application float64 `protobuf:"fixed64,5,opt,name=application,proto3" json:"application,omitempty"`
// contains filtered or unexported fields
}
MintAllocationPercentages represents the distribution of newly minted tokens, at the end of claim settlement, as a result of the Global Mint TLM.

type Params ¶
type Params struct {
// mint_allocation_percentages represents the distribution of newly minted tokens,
// at the end of claim settlement, as a result of the Global Mint TLM.
MintAllocationPercentages *MintAllocationPercentages `` /* 138-byte string literal not displayed */
// dao_reward_address is the address to which mint_allocation_dao percentage of the
// minted tokens are at the end of claim settlement.
DaoRewardAddress string `protobuf:"bytes,6,opt,name=dao_reward_address,json=daoRewardAddress,proto3" json:"dao_reward_address,omitempty"` // Bech32 cosmos address
// global_inflation_per_claim is the percentage of a claim's claimable uPOKT amount which will be minted on settlement.
GlobalInflationPerClaim float64 `` /* 136-byte string literal not displayed */
// contains filtered or unexported fields
}
Params defines the parameters for the tokenomics module.
